- processes & practices reason mitzi has 79 coins. she divides the coins equally among herself and her 3 brothers. mitzi will keep any coins left over. how many coins does each person get?
Step1: Determine the number of people
Mitzi and her 3 brothers, so total people is \(1 + 3=4\).
Step2: Divide the total coins by the number of people
We have 79 coins and 4 people. So we do the division \(79\div4\).
When we divide 79 by 4, \(4\times19 = 76\) and \(79-76 = 3\). So the quotient is 19 and the remainder is 3. But the question is how many coins each person gets (the quotient, since the remainder is kept by Mitzi, but each person gets the equal part). Wait, actually, when dividing equally, each person gets the quotient, and the remainder is the extra Mitzi keeps. So \(79\div4 = 19\) with a remainder of 3. So each person gets 19 coins, and Mitzi keeps the 3 extra.
